BOWA NAMED 2017 REGIONAL CONTRACTOR OF THE YEAR BY NARI

2017 Regional COTY Winner The National Association of the Remodeling Industry Names Winners of Annual Competition

McLean, Va. – BOWA (bowa.com), a residential design and construction firm specializing in luxury additions and renovations, is pleased to announce that the National Association of the Remodeling Industry (NARI) has named BOWA the 2017 Southeast Regional CotY TM winner in the Entire House Over $1,000,000 category.

“With projects ranging from master suites and kitchens to whole-home renovations such as this one, it’s an honor to be recognized by our industry leaders for our work at this and all levels,” said Josh Baker, Founder and Co-Chairman at BOWA. “We are thankful for the continued opportunity to work with and design creative solutions for wonderful clients.”

Contractors from seven regions around the country vie for CotY Awards each year. Judging is based on problem solving, functionality, aesthetics, craftsmanship, innovation, degree of difficulty by an impartial panel of industry experts. The 172 Regional CotY TM Winners from the competition will advance as finalists at the national level and national winners will be announced on April 7, 2017.

Regional Contractor of the Year Winning Project in Loudoun County - Before Whole-House Renovation in Loudoun County

BOWA’s winning project in the “Entire House over $1,000,000” category, is in Waterford, Virginia. This design build transformation overhauled a significantly dated farmhouse into a spacious, rustic-themed home with a contemporary look, abundant natural light and plenty of room for entertaining family and friends. A three-story addition, numerous windows, sleek barrel-vault ceiling in the dining area, and the adjacent outdoor pavilion and deck area all contribute to achieving the clients’ goals.  This project was also the winner in its category for the NARI’s local chapter Capital CotY competition, as well as the 2016 NVBIA/MNCBIA’s Great American Living Awards.
